Karma! Excavator plunges into ditch as it knocks down 'sacred' Buddhist tree
An excavator fell into a ditch as it knocked down a sacred Buddhist tree - with locals believing the driver was hit with instant karma.
The construction vehicle was clearing a plot of land including the decades old hardwood believed to have been a lucky tree in Bangkok, Thailand, on February 28.
But right after the driver demolished the tree, estimated to be at least a hundred years old by locals, the machinery fell into the hole with water.
Footage shows the excavator's arm uprooting the tree before the ground gave in.
Resident Thanthida Boonyoo said: ‘The monks already advised to do a ceremony for the tree before the construction. It had been there for a long time. I believe it is unlucky to remove it just like that.'
The driver clambered from the wreckage and was unhurt but shaken.
